Background
The double-sided digital printing machine comprises a front sprayer and a back sprayer, the front sprayer and the back sprayer are used for printing the front surface and the back surface of paper, the front sprayer and the back sprayer are generally in a flat layout, the front sprayer, a front drying oven, a back sprayer and a back drying oven are arranged in a straight line, the paper is turned over between the front sprayer and the back sprayer by guiding a paper path, and the paper sequentially passes through the front sprayer, the front drying oven, a paper turning mechanism, the back sprayer and the back drying oven along the straight line.
The drying problem is one of the key difficulties that the digital printer cannot work normally. The method specifically comprises the following reasons:
1. the jet printing unit and the drying unit are stacked up and down, and the drying unit is too short in length due to space limitation, so that the full drying of large-ink-amount jet printing is difficult to realize;
2. the drying unit is arranged below the jet printing unit, and the normal work of the upper jet printing is influenced by the heating of the lower part because the heat transfer cannot be completely isolated.
3. The drying path is too short, and the drying capacity is insufficient, so that the jet printing quality cannot be guaranteed.

The specific working principle is as follows:
one end of the paper roll 3 is pulled out to form a paper tape, the paper tape is firstly corrected through the deviation corrector 5, then the front side of the paper tape is sprayed and printed through the first spraying and printing unit 8, the paper tape after spraying and printing enters the lengthening oven 9 (the paper tape enters from the first inlet 91 and is dried for one time and then penetrates out from the first outlet 94), the front side of the paper tape is dried for one time, the dried paper tape passes through the second spraying and printing unit 10 to spray and print the back side of the paper tape, after the spraying and printing of the back side of the paper tape is finished, the paper tape passes through the lengthening oven 9 (enters from the second inlet 93 and is dried, and then penetrates out from the second outlet 96), the back side of the paper tape is dried, finally, the paper tape passes through the reversing, enters the lengthening oven 9 for the third time (enters from the third inlet 95 and finally penetrates out from the third outlet 92) to be dried, and after the drying, the paper tape passes out to enter the subsequent processing.
